While portable technology empowers users to bypass censorship, it also raises significant security and ethical questions. The very portability that allows devices to evade scrutiny also makes them susceptible to theft, hacking, or government confiscation. Users must employ robust encryption, regularly update software, and remain vigilant about phishing attempts to mitigate risks. Additionally, the use of censored content via portable devices often exists in a legal gray area.
